Jens Dethloff (born February 8, 1982 in Bützow ) is a German handball player and handball trainer .

Dethloff came through the clubs TSV Bützow 1952 eV, Schwaaner SV and the HC Empor B and A-Jugend in 2001 to join the first men's team of HC Empor Rostock , which plays in the second handball league . In the 2002/2003 season he had a double play right for the then regional league team of TSV Bützow.

In 2007 he was voted player of the season 2006/2007 by the fans of the 1st men's team of HC Empor on a website.

The right-hander now plays in the center of the circle.

In November 2011 he was appointed interim coach at HC Empor Rostock together with Michal Brůna .
